      Job Description:

      Responsible for managing and enhancing banking products, services and controls. Provides innovative value propositions and product solutions that address needs of the affluent and high net worth customer. Carries out product's strategic plan and project performance metrics and forecasts. Understands and communicates gaps in product offerings and develops action plans. Has experience in financial services industry and demonstrates key strengths in product management, product development, and strategic marketing.

      Responsibilities:

      • Subject matter expert on the multiple lending platforms supporting the GWIM Credit products

      • Responsible for understanding available functionality and strategies to determine what enhancements are required to address gaps and drive industry leading capabilities within the business

      • Once solutions are defined, activity will shift to developing strong requirements, implementation plans, and driving execution

      • Candidate must be able to interact with a variety of key stakeholders including Product Owners, Sales Teams, Operations, Legal, Risk and Compliance, Marketing and Communication

      • Responsibility and accountability - both personal accountability and the leadership skills to hold others accountable

      • Working knowledge of GWIM Credit products, technology platforms and organizational structure

      • Effective project management and organizational skills; ability to collaborate, manage, influence, and expand relationships across the organization and with all levels of management, setting expectations and holding people accountable as necessary

      • Proficient in business analysis with the ability to research issues and gather requirements

      • Partner with application technology teams to drive technology solutions to meet business requirements

      • Understanding of technology platforms and business requirements

      • Ability to effectively analyze project risk and manage and escalate accordingly

      • Ability to manage all aspects of the technology project lifecycle from define through implementation and support

      Bank of America is one of the world's largest financial institutions, serving individuals, small- and middle-market businesses and large corporations with a full range of banking, investing, asset management and other financial and risk management products and services.
